The Brooklin Whitby Garden Club brings experienced gardeners and authors to Whitby to share their knowledge and expertise.
The Language of Gardening; What exactly IS a Perennial, Annual, Shrub, etc., and why does it matter to know? Tubers ... corms bulbs...stolons...rhizomes...fibrous... they are all roots, but knowing what the differences are helps understand best maintenance. What do the terms "Hardy" or "Tender" on the plant labels mean when you're considering a purchase or how to grow? What exactly is a "Hardiness Zone" and how does this determine what you can grow in YOUR garden? Botanical Latin plant names? Learn about this in this incredible seminar.
